Typhoon Shelter cuisine is a delicacy from Hong Kong. It is usually used to cook seafood, but what I made today is a vegan lotus root. No matter how picky the child is, he can't stop his delicacy. 😊😊😊"

Typhoon Shelter Lotus Root

1. Prepare two fresh tender lotus roots. When choosing lotus roots, we have to choose tender and crispy ones. Peel and slice. Rinse repeatedly with clean water.

2. Two eggs, fried chicken powder and flour are mixed into a yogurt-like batter. If there is no fried chicken powder, use flour directly. You can add a little salt.

3. When the pan is 60% of the oil temperature, put the lotus root in the paste, slice by slice. Blow him up quickly. Lotus root can be eaten raw, so it must be fried fast.

4. Fire up after all of them are blown up. Re-fry for 30 seconds to make it more crispy.

5. Lift the pot to control the oil.

6. Prepare a little more garlic, I used one so much. Press it into garlic paste, millet spicy and 2 vitex strips cut into circles and set aside.

7. Wash the pot and pour a little oil. Fry the garlic on low heat.

8. Add the bread crumbs and stir-fry it evenly.

9. Turn to high heat, add lotus root slices and 2 vitex millet spicy, stir fry quickly.

10. Add the right amount of salt and white pepper.

11. Very delicious.

Tips:

When frying this dish, the hand speed must be fast, because if the garlic is fried for too long, it will have a little bitter taste.
